Sealing

Window seals (also known as uPVC seals) play an important role in insulation and double-glazed windows. Faulty seals can lead to condensation, drafts and other issues. Fortunately, damaged seals can be replaced or repaired to improve the efficiency of your double glazing.

Leaks of water in glass panes is a typical sign of double-glazed windows that need to be sealed. This moisture can damage the frames of your windows and increase the cost of energy. The moisture between the glass can cause a foggy appearance that can come and go depending on indoor/outdoor temperatures or humidity levels.

Glass

Double-glazed windows are made up of two panes of glass with an air gap between. The air is filled with gases such as argon and krypton which slow down the heat transfer through your windows. This helps to keep your home at a pleasant temperature without straining your cooling and heating system. If one of your double glazed windows breaks or cracks, you'll want to repair it swiftly.

Usually replacing the glass in your double glazed window repairs is the best way to fix it. It's important to realize that fixing double-paned windows requires more than simply replacing the glass. It also involves restoring the factory seal to ensure that your window repairs functions just as it should. Misting is a common problem when it comes to double-glazed windows. This occurs when the seal between the glass panel fails and moisture-laden air can enter between the glass panes. This could cause the glass to become foggy or wet and also degrades the insulating ability of your double glazed windows.

Hardware

When it comes to double-glazed windows, there are various problems that could develop over time. These can include issues with seals, water intrusion and foggy glass. Many people believe they need to replace their entire window when these problems occur. However, most of them can be repaired.

The first step in repairing double-glazed windows is to remove the old pane. To avoid further damage to the glass, you should take care when removing the pane. The next step is to take off any sealants or paint around the edges of your glass. This can be accomplished with the help of a putty knife or scraper. Once the old pane is removed, the new pane can be placed in the frame. A new layer of sealant needs to be applied.

If the window is covered by warranty, you may be able to have the manufacturer to replace the glass unit free of charge. If not, engage a professional to look over and repair the window.

The hardware is just as important as the glass in a double-glazed window. The sash as well as the balance are used to open and close the window. If these components are damaged, it could be difficult to use the window and can even create safety hazards.
